We Are All Born Free is an inspiring picture book that brings the Universal Declaration of Human Rights to life for young readers aged six and above. Through evocative illustrations by internationally acclaimed artists, this collection celebrates the fundamental rights everyone is entitled to, fostering a sense of respect, compassion, and justice. Published in association with Amnesty International and featuring a foreword by David Tennant and John Boyne, this book makes an excellent educational tool for introducing concepts of equality and human dignity in classrooms and homes alike.

Educational Benefits:

  • Introduces human rights principles in an accessible and age-appropriate way.
  • Supports development of social awareness and global citizenship.
  • Encourages empathy and respect for diversity and difference.
  • Provides a historical context linked to post-World War Two global efforts.

Classroom Ideas:

  • Facilitate discussions about fairness, justice, and equality.
  • Integrate with social studies lessons on human rights and history.
  • Encourage students to create their own human rights artwork or posters.
  • Use as a prompt for writing exercises on personal rights and responsibilities.
